Old Flamingo.

July 28, 2011 by Michelle Hinckley |

Last week my three little men and I were going stir crazy in the apartment.
I made them a proposition…a trip to the park in exchange for a trip to a furniture store.

DEAL.

After the trip to the park we found ourselves at the Old Flamigo in Holladay, UT.  We were actually lured in by the ugliest snow cone shack you’ve ever seen.  They were operating out of an old grey camper that was sitting in the parking lot with a line of people a mile long. Surprisingly the sugared snow was delicious.  Anyway, the Old Flamingo had all kinds of interesting vintage treasures.  I loved most everything but there was one particular piece that made my heart go pitter-patter which I’ll share with you tomorrow.
In the meantime, check out a few of their things…

 

If you’re in Salt Lake and looking for a fun field trip
(or a cold, tasty treat sold out of an old grey camper) check them out here.
